Previous (Jan): 183k Forecast: 140k
Private sector companies added more jobs than expected in January, furthering the case for a stable labour market, ADP reported. But All of the job creation came from service providers
Companies created 183,000 jobs on the month, slightly more than the 176,000 in December, a number that was revised from the initial figure of 122,000. Again it differed significantly from what NFP reported later.
